An illegal alien who worked as an Idaho ranch hand faces up to life in prison without parole, and deportation, after pleading no contest to killing and decapitating a northeast Nevada woman in 2016.
47-year-old Jose de Jesus Segundo-Huizar entered his plea Monday in Elko District Court in the slaying of Carmen Magallanes-Sanchez. Prosecutors aren’t sure about the motive for the slaying, but that Segundo-Huizar said he knew Magalanes-Sanchez. Segundo-Huizar lived in Jerome, Idaho. He remains jailed in Elko pending sentencing. Magalanes-Sanchez lived with her boyfriend in the small town of Ryndon, Nevada.
